Frequently Asked Questions about Florida Oranges VS Artichokes

What are the health benefits of Florida Oranges compared to Artichokes?

Florida oranges are a great source of vitamin C, which supports the immune system and skin health. They also contain folate and potassium. Artichokes, on the other hand, are rich in fiber, antioxidants, and vitamins C and K. Both are nutritious choices, but artichokes may provide more fiber and antioxidants compared to Florida oranges.

Can I lose weight easier by eating more Florida Oranges or Artichokes?

Both Florida oranges and artichokes can be beneficial for weight loss due to their high fiber content and low calorie density. However, if you are looking to lose weight, it is important to focus on a well-rounded diet that includes a variety of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and legumes. Incorporating a mix of different foods will provide your body with a wide range of nutrients and help you feel satisfied while reducing overall calorie intake. Remember, weight loss is ultimately achieved by creating a calorie deficit, so it's important to focus on overall dietary patterns rather than specific "superfoods."
